Firmware Engineer - Firmware Development

Flowserve Corporation

Bengaluru, India
Low-power electronics firmware development
Embedded c/c++ programming
Real-time embedded firmware development
You will be part of an exciting new team involved in application design and developing real-time embedded firmware for microcontrollers

Job Summary

  • You will be part of an exciting new team involved in application design and developing real-time embedded firmware for microcontrollers.
  • The role includes designing to meet the requirements of functional safety standards and troubleshooting firmware bugs to validate functionality.
  • You will work with a variety of peripheral components and industrial communication protocols, integrating hardware with Python applications.

Matching Summary

You will be part of an exciting new team involved in application design and developing real-time embedded firmware for microcontrollers.

Skills & Requirements

Must-have

  • Low-power electronics firmware development
  • Embedded C/C++ programming
  • Real-time embedded firmware development
  • Functional safety standards compliance
  • Microcontroller peripheral communication
  • Industrial communication protocols knowledge
  • RTOS operating system experience

Nice-to-have

  • Python hardware integration
  • Assembly language programming
  • Software debugging and emulation
  • Lab equipment usage
  • Distributed control systems knowledge

Key Requirements

  • Bachelor or Master’s degree in relevant engineering fields
  • Minimum 7 years experience in low-power electronics firmware development
  • Experience with IAR Workbench, Kiel IDE, SVN, Visual Studio
  • Knowledge of RENESAS, TI, ARM Cortex processors
  • Experience with industrial communication protocols
  • Experience with RTOS

Work Rights

Not specified

Tailored Resume

Cover Letter